Handover from the Relaybot deploy-status project: plugin authors hook into the status poller, not the chat gateway directly, so keep payloads under the documented size cap. Tove finished the retry logic last sprint; the only open item is webhook signature validation for third-party plugins. Everything plugin-facing is driven by one config file, reproduced below so you can verify defaults before publishing.

settings of fafog-haduf:
ZORIX_PIN=4648
ZORIX_METRICS_HOST=metrics.zorix.paliqsys.corp
ZORIX_LOG_LEVEL=info
ZORIX_TENANT=druix

Snapshot testing in the Fernwick UI library works as follows: every component under packages/fernwick-core has a stored snapshot, and CI fails on any pixel diff above threshold. Reviewers should reject PRs that blindly regenerate snapshots without explanation. If a legitimate visual change lands, approve the snapshot update and note the reason in the PR. Updating the baseline store requires unlocking the Fernwick assets account, and the recovery flow for that account asks for the passphrase below.

strongbox words: norwyn-wenael-aldvan-aldiel-wendor-holael

- [ ] Verify the barcode scanner integration before sealing the Orvalith key ceremony. The release manager must confirm that the Trellich scanner firmware reads the ceremony batch labels at station three, and that scan events land in the audit ledger within two seconds. If the scanner drops offline mid-ceremony, pause and re-run the calibration strip rather than entering codes by hand. Once the final scan is logged and witnessed by both custodians, record the recovery passphrase below.

vault phrase of kawep-tahog = ulaix-briath